How much could you accomplish in three weeks?

Do you ever wonder what you could accomplish if you eliminated all distractions and pushed yourself to the max? You couldn't do it for long or you'd go crazy, but how about three weeks? What if you slept, ate, exercised a few days a week, and spent 100% of the rest of your time on your business. No TV, no social outings, no boning around online reading blogs :)

The last few months of my life as an engineer I shared a large cubicle with an older engineer named Paul. When I put in my two weeks, Paul and I started talking about business. Turns out Paul spent the majority of his professional career running a business and he and I had several long talks about anything and everything related to entrepreneurship.

When I *complained* about having to move from CT to Albany, say goodbye to all of my friends, sure up my health insurance, and try to wrap up all of my work...all while still trying to grow my business, he looked me in the eye and told me that I could do it. That when he first decided to become a business owner he bought a house, married, went on a honeymoon, quit his job, and started his business - ALL IN THREE WEEKS!

That's a lifetime for most people. Most people couldn't handle all of those things at once. But it is possible. Sometimes I think we sell ourselves short by saying that we're "doing enough" and not pushing ourselves into greatness. You can do more. I can do more. How much could you do in three weeks if your back was against the wall? Could you do what Paul did?
